There is plenty to do at IC. Whether there is enough to do will depend on what your daughter wants to do. The thing about Ithaca is that you will have plenty of choices: 1) outdoor life (Ithaca is Gorges, you know) 2) Ithaca Downtown (restaurants, shopping) 3) Collegetown (restaurants, bars, clubs) 4) Cornell and Ithaca campus events 5) "classical" concerts at both IC and Cornell 6...
